Abstract
The experimental equipment and the general method of modeling of electromagnetic wave processes in multicoupled quasi-optical systems are described. Examples of choosing the optimum modes of modeling and basic parameters of the investigated electrodynamic systems are shown. The functional diagram of the experimental plant is also described. The general method of modeling of electromagnetic phenomena in resonant and wave-guide multicoupled quasi-optical systems is presented for the first time.
